It has been a relatively quiet weekend, unless you include the rampant transfer rumors surrounding Brad Guzan (Celtic, Arsenal, Olympiakos) and Eddie Johnson (Derby, Fulham and Reading). I will look to have some info on these rumors during the week.
The FA Cup has ruled the weekend, with struggling Fulham suffering yet ANOTHER disappointing result, this time a 2-2 tie against Bristol Rovers.
I passed over one major signing of the past week, Valencia’s acquisition of Boca Juniors starlet Ever Banega. It will be interesting to see where David Albelda winds up. The Spanish international is suing to have his contract voided after being told he wouldn’t see any more first-team action this season.
